Quick answer. Hiro Hamada #214 from the Archazia's Island set is a sought-after Enchanted rarity card in the Disney Lorcana game, known for its vibrant artwork by Rachel Elese. Collectors value this card for its unique design and connection to the beloved character from Disney's 'Big Hero 6.' Live: As of Aug 5, 2026, a raw near-mint copy is worth about $46.39, and PSA 10 context is around $1,000. Figures update from Cardmarket, TCGplayer and eBay sold data.

Grading and Its Impact on Value

When it comes to trading cards, grading plays a significant role in determining worth. Hiro Hamada #214 can be assessed through professional grading services, which evaluate factors such as centering, corners, edges, and surface quality. Cards that receive higher grades tend to command better prices in the market, as collectors seek out pristine examples. However, even raw copies of this card can hold value, particularly if they are well-preserved. Understanding the grading process can help collectors make informed decisions when buying or selling.
